Mailinglisten-Archive |
On Wed, 8 Mar 2000, [iso-8859-1] Kai Hörner wrote:
> From: rik <rik_(at)_shorebreak.de>
> > > gibt es eine einfache Möglichkeit in einer Zahl, also z.B. 3800,
> > > vor den letzten beiden Stellen ein Komma einzufügen, das daraus
> > > z.B. 38,00 wird?
>
> > http://www.php.net/manual/function.str-replace.php3
> > http://www.php.net/manual/function.ereg-replace.php3
> > $new_number = str_replace(".", ",", $number);
> > oder
> > $new_number = ereg_replace(".",",",$number);
>
> Siehst du da im String "3800" irgendwo nen punkt? Also ich nicht....
> naja nicht für Ungut.....
>
> > oder guck mal unter
> > http://www.php.net/manual/function.number-format.php3
>
> <?php
> $numbertoformat = 321554;
> $number1 = substr($numbertoformat, 0, strlen($numbertoformat) - 2);
> $number2 = substr($numbertoformat, strlen($numbertoformat) - 2,
> strlen($numbertoformat));
> echo $number1 . "," . $number2;
> ?>
>
> das kann dir helfen.
Oh mein Herr, schmeiss Hirn rah! Wie einfach es doch ist eine Zahl durch
Hundert zu teilen und das ganze dann mit number_format() zu formatieren.
-Egon
--
Grueninger Str. 6, 70599 Stuttgart
http://php.net/manual/, http://php.net/books.php3
http://www.uni-hohenheim.de/~windband
php::bar PHP Wiki - Listenarchive